H&R Block, Inc. (HRB)

HRB pays a 3.10% distribution rate, quarterly. Its Distribution Safety Score™ is 87 (Safe), giving a Safety-Adjusted Yield of 2.70%. Its deepest 1-year drawdown was 45.6%.

H&R Block provides tax return preparation services through assisted and DIY platforms in the United States, Canada, and Australia, along with ancillary financial services including refund loans, identity protection, prepaid debit cards, and small business solutions like payroll and payment processing.
